What is Network Monitoring and Why Do I Need It?

Network monitoring is at the heart of Data Integrity Services’ proactive approach. They utilize sophisticated tools to continuously monitor network performance, server health, and security threats. This extends beyond simple “up/down” status checks; they analyze bandwidth usage, identify potential bottlenecks, and detect suspicious activity. Typically, these tools employ Security Information and Event Management (SIEM) systems, which correlate events from various sources to identify potential threats. For instance, unusual login attempts, large data transfers, or access to sensitive files can trigger alerts. Interestingly, many businesses assume they are adequately protected by basic firewalls, however, these often fail to detect advanced threats like ransomware or phishing attacks. Data Integrity Services’ approach includes vulnerability assessments and penetration testing, which actively seek out weaknesses in a client’s system before malicious actors can exploit them. They also provide detailed reporting on network performance and security posture, enabling clients to make informed decisions about their IT infrastructure.

How Does Data Integrity Services Handle Cybersecurity Threats?

Cybersecurity is paramount in today’s digital landscape, and Data Integrity Services offers a multi-layered approach to protecting client data. Notwithstanding the increasing sophistication of cyberattacks, their strategies focus on prevention, detection, and response. They implement robust firewall configurations, intrusion detection systems, and endpoint protection software. Furthermore, they conduct regular security awareness training for employees, educating them about phishing scams, social engineering tactics, and other common threats. A particularly important component is data backup and disaster recovery planning. Data Integrity Services utilizes both on-site and off-site backup solutions, ensuring that client data can be restored quickly and efficiently in the event of a system failure or cyberattack. Approximately 30% of ransomware attacks target small businesses, highlighting the importance of a proactive cybersecurity strategy. It’s not enough to simply have backups; they must be tested regularly to ensure their integrity and recoverability. They also assist clients with compliance requirements, such as HIPAA, PCI DSS, and GDPR.
